Secondly, the brand reputation and build quality also play a pivotal role in determining the price. Renowned brands that have been in the market for years tend to command higher prices due to their reliability and warranty provisions. On the other hand, less-known brands may offer lower prices, but potential buyers should consider the long-term investment and durability of the equipment.
Another critical factor influencing the price is the technology incorporated into the machine. Modern servicing machines that come with advanced features such as automated functions, digital displays, and connectivity options can be significantly more expensive. These high-tech machines not only enhance precision and efficiency but also reduce labor time, making them worthwhile for busy workshops.
Moreover, the location and shipping costs should not be overlooked. If a workshop is located in a remote area, transportation of the machinery can add substantial costs. Purchasing from local suppliers can help mitigate these additional expenses, making it a smart choice for many business owners.
Furthermore, ongoing maintenance and the availability of spare parts should be considered when examining the overall cost of car servicing machines. Machines that require specific parts or have limited technical support can lead to increased servicing costs in the long run.
In conclusion, the price of car servicing machines can vary widely based on type, brand, technology, location, and maintenance considerations. For automotive professionals, making an informed decision involves evaluating these factors to ensure they invest in machines that not only meet their current needs but also provide reliability and efficiency for years to come.
